1964 was born in Hong Kong, with a ancestral home in Shanghai, a national first-class actor, and an honorary doctorate from the University of Edinburgh.

1983 Miss Hong Kong runner-up and officially debuted. After his debut, he has starred in countless classic movies, won five Hong Kong Film Awards Best Actress Awards and five Taiwan Golden Horse Awards Best Actress Awards. He is the first best actress in the Chinese film industry.

2004 " Clean " won the Best Actress Award at the 57th Cannes International Film Festival.

won the Art Achievement Award at the 29th Montreal International Film Festival in 2005.

Maggie Cheung represents the highest level of Chinese women's acting skills now. She has worked with countless actors and has collaborated with the four kings of and the most movies.
